What is a sample demonstrator?

Sample demonstrators are individuals who showcase products to potential customers, typically in retail stores, supermarkets, or trade shows. Their main responsibility is to engage with shoppers, explain the features and benefits of a product, and often offer free samples for customers to try. This helps boost product awareness and can increase sales by allowing customers to experience the product firsthand. Sample demonstrators need strong communication skills and a friendly demeanor to effectively interact with the public.

What are some common challenges faced by sample demonstrators during in-store events?

Sample Demonstrators often encounter challenges such as engaging reluctant shoppers, managing high foot traffic during peak hours, and ensuring compliance with store policies and food safety standards. Adapting to different store layouts and maintaining an approachable, positive attitude are also key to success. Effective communication and multitasking are essential, as Sample Demonstrators must answer questions, replenish samples, and keep the demonstration area clean, all while promoting the featured product.
